HTTP Pages

Clicking the HTTP link in the menu bar displays the HTTP Statistics page. This page has
three links at the top for viewing statistics and for viewing and changing configuration and
authentication settings.

HTTP Statistics Page

The HTTP Statistics page displays when you click HTTP in the menu bar. It also displays
when you click Statistics at the top of one of the other HTTP pages. This read-only page
shows various statistics about the Hyper Text Transfer Protocol (HTTP) server.

HTTP Configuration Page

If you click Configuration at the top of one of the HTTP pages, the HTTP Configuration
page displays. Here you can change HTTP configuration settings.
Under Current Configuration, Logs has View and Clear links that let you view or clear
the log. If you click View, the log displays. If you click Clear, a message asks whether
you are sure you want to delete this information. Click OK to proceed or Cancel to cancel
the operation.
